Address NGHSHfGst5Fg8mFv1H5iEDWZq3n2FC6vvr

Total received 52.35111801 NMC
Total sent 52.35111801 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 28, 2022, 3:40 p.m. 87bfd1d8a… 609716 52.35111801 NMC 0.00000000 NMC
April 28, 2022, 3:40 p.m. 00939560d… 609716 52.35111801 NMC 0.00000000 NMC